Welcome to Istabul!
Arrival 10:00am departure 7:30pm
Istanbul (formally Constantinople) is the capital of Istanbul Province, and the largest city in Turkey. The province and the city are situated on both sides of the Bosporus, The strait that separates Europe from Asia.
Excursion- Blue Mosque, Hagia Sophia, Topkapi Palace, Grand Bazaar and of course a Turkish rug demonstration.

Welcome to Mykonos!!
Arrival 11:30am departure 10:30pm.
The dry and rugged island of Mykonos is one of the smallest of the Cycladic group. An ancient myth tells that rocks strewn across its barren landscape are the solidified remains of the giant slain by Hercules. Mykanos has become one of the most popular of the Aegean Islands.
Excursion- Delos Apollo Sanctuary
Delos is an island sanctuary. It was revered as the birthplace of Apollo and his twin sister Artemis. Its vast archaeological site has revealed grand temples, and the most complete residential quarter surviving from ancient Greece. Situated at the center of Cyclades, Delos was not only the spiritual focus of the ancient Greeks' ethnic identity, but also a highly prosperous grain port and slave market. At its height, the latter had a "turnover" of 10,000 slaves a day.

Welcome to Santorini!!
Santorini is the southernmost of the Cyclades group in the south Aegean Sea and is on the northern edge of the Sea of Crete. The island and its surrounding islets are formed from the rim of an ancient drowned volcano that exploded in about 1628 BC.
We arrived at 8am and departed at 7:45pm. On this island we took a tour of Thira and Oia Village then had some time for shopping, lunch and drinks in the beautiful sunshine overlooking the Sea.
